| | | Porpoise in the Gorbals Down at my rowing club in Glasgow today and an unexpected visitor put in an appearance. Very difficult to get pictures so these are all at a wide angle as it would pop up anywhere within a 400 m radius
Malcolm |

| | | Re: Porpoise in the Gorbals That's right - It's quite literally a building site just now as there is a new path being built along the south side of the river.
I don't know where it will be now. I reported it to the SSPCA so hopefully they'll have guided it down below the weir. If it is still where it was on Wednesday the best place for a good view would be Polmadie footbridge then along the path to Kings bridge. It was breaching a lot just a few yards downstream of Polmadie bridge for wahtever reason. |

| | | Re: Porpoise in the Gorbals There was a load of media hype about this - most of it rubbish. As you can see from my post the porpoise had been in the water for some time above the weir before the TV crews cottoned on a week later. Indeed it was reported in the Sun newspaper the day after I reported it here.
In fact one of the lads in our club said he saw it again on Saturday - although I have my suspicions that was a seal that I took a photograph of. Seals frequently appear around Glasgow green. |
